Despite its numbering Star Wreck 4½ - Weak Performance was actually made after Star Wreck V, even though most of it is re-used footage from Andy Bones II, made years earlier... Confused? So is the plot, where Captain Pirk plays Andy Bones on the Halludeck while Romuclans attack The Kickstart.

Trivia, insights & behind the scenes
This entire franchise started as a single teenager's (Samuli Torssonen) animation experiments in 1992, eventually growing into actual feature films with Hollywood distribution.
The 'Star Wreck' series became a proof-of-concept for Finnish fan-made genre cinema, directly enabling director Timo Vuorensola's later Nazi-moon-base film 'Iron Sky' and its crowdfunding success.
